### Runbook: Broker Upgrade (Pipewren 3.x → 4.x)

For this week's sync: the Pipewren broker upgrade proceeds in three stages — drain consumers on the standby node, roll the binary, then rebalance partitions. Expect roughly twelve minutes of degraded throughput per node; no message loss if drains complete. Rollback is a binary swap plus partition reassignment. Staging completed cleanly on Monday. The staging run's build token is below.

build token for yajof-bajof: htk31_506ff1188f74596b5bb2eec94edc43c

## Step 4 — Reconfigure the Reminder Job

Before enabling the new scheduler for Clinicbell's appointment reminder job, verify that step 3 completed and the legacy cron entry is disabled. The job now reads its settings from the central config store rather than the bundled properties file, so any stale local file must be deleted. After cleanup, load the following configuration values into the store.

deployment values, kajep-kageg:
[praix]
host = praix.paliqcorp.corp
user = praix_svc
database = praix_prod

## Runbook: Feedwright validator stuck

If the Feedwright podcast feed validator starts flagging every feed as malformed, it's almost always a stale schema cache, not an actual outage. First, restart the cache warmer on the mill-7 worker pool and re-queue the last hour of feeds. If that doesn't clear it, hit the validator's admin endpoint directly to force a schema refresh. That endpoint requires the on-call service key, which is listed just below.

API key for yahig-tadup: kto7_ubizbYm

Management Meeting Minutes — Discount Policy

Attendees: full leadership team. Agreed: deals above 500 units require sign-off from Halverton or delegate. Standard cap set at 14%; exceptions logged centrally. Quist to draft escalation matrix by Friday. Tavenner raised margin erosion on the Ridgemoor account; deferred to next session. Approved unanimously. The confidential planning note follows below.

board note of fafog-yahap: Project Rusdor slips by a full year because of the audit delay.